Caregivers in the Labor, Delivery, Recovery and Postpartum (LDRP)/Family Birth Place unit care for mothers and their newborns by managing labor, vaginal delivery, recovery, postpartum and well newborn care. As Nursing Clinical Clerical, you will assist with various tasks, including both administrative functions and direct patient care. On the clerical end, you will perform data collection, maintain a safe environment and ensure an adequate level of supplies. Alongside a fellow nurse, you will ensure patients receive the correct treatments and daily support as indicated. This role offers a unique way to enhance both your administrative and nursing skills in a welcoming, supportive healthcare setting.
A caregiver in this role works nights from 7:00 p.m. – 7:30 a.m. with weekend and holiday requirements
A caregiver who excels in this role will:
Provide patient care under the direction of an RN.
Assist with data collection and treatments.
Perform administrative functions for the unit.
Observe and report changes in patients’ condition.
Document activities in the patient care record.
Assist with transporting and discharging patients.
Transcribe and process all orders.
Prepare, maintain and process all charts, filed, records and mail.
Maintain inventory.
Minimum q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include:
High School Diploma or GED
Basic Life Support (BLS) certification through the American Heart Association (AHA) before or within the new hire period
Proficient in applied mathematics and reading comprehension at an eighth-grade level
Basic computer skills
Preferred q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include:
Previous health care and patient care experience in a hospital
Completion of a Medical Assisting course
State Tested Nurse Assistant (STNA)

Physical Requirements:
Requires full body motion to move and lift patients, manual finger dexterity with good eye-hand coordination; involves extensive standing and walking.
Medium Work - Exerting 20 to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 10 to 25 pounds of force frequently, and/or greater than negligible up to 10 pounds of force constantly to move objects.
Physical Demand requirements are in excess of those for Light Work.
